Team Leader and Full Time/Bank Support Workers

Location: BN10 area (Peacehaven, East Sussex)

Salary: Weekday - A£15.30 per hour, Weekend - A£17.10 per hour, Waking Night - A£15.30 per hour, Team Leader Premium - A£100.00 per week

Hours: Hours of work include weekdays, weekends, bank holidays, and school holidays on a rolling rota basis. Shifts generally run from 7.30am to 5.00pm, 5.00pm to 10.00pm, and waking nights, but these hours can vary.

Vacancy Type: Permanent

Want to Make a Genuine Difference? Join The Team and Help a Young Man Live Life to the Full!

Are you enthusiastic, compassionate, and ready to bring energy and positivity into someone's life?

On behalf of their client, the company are recruiting a team of support workers to provide 24-hour one-to-one support.

They're seeking the right team to support a young man in his 30s who is navigating life after a brain injury. He has a great sense of humour, big dreams, and a strong desire to live as independently as possible, make new friends, and explore his community.

While he experiences significant cognitive challenges and needs support with planning, organising and staying engaged, he's full of potential - and he's looking for someone who believes in him and can empower him to increase his independence and experience some fun along the way. Their client is registered blind due to having a visual impairment.

The Support Worker Role:

* Support with daily routines and planning activities and engage him in enjoyable and meaningful pursuits.
* Encourage social connection and participation in the community.
* Help foster independence and confidence in everyday tasks-assist with cooking, shopping, general tidying, attending appointments, and any other activities the day brings.
* Be a reliable, friendly presence-and share a laugh or two along the way!
* You will work as part of a multidisciplinary team and under the guidance of their client's therapists to assist in his rehabilitation.
